Output 43a52074364150b5c23f178f9d126d1893ef16b367ba20518fede15b7fd25b46:1

value
685603835
script pubkey
OP_0 OP_PUSHBYTES_20 c35d07ce4fdf511492ff44f728b2b5ef28cd26a9
address
ltc1qcdws0nj0mag3fyhlgnmj3v44au5v6f4fq33al4
transaction
43a52074364150b5c23f178f9d126d1893ef16b367ba20518fede15b7fd25b46
spent
true